Q: Is 6,082,880 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 6,082,880 is a composite number.

Why is 6,082,880 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 6,082,880 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 8 10 16 20 32 40 64 80 160 320 19,009 38,018 76,036 95,045 152,072 190,090 304,144 380,180 608,288 760,360 1,216,576 1,520,720 3,041,440 and 6,082,880, with no remainder.

Since 6,082,880 cannot be divided by just 1 and 6,082,880, it is a composite number.
